We need a schema check on every word-list upload plus a canary puzzle solved end-to-end before publish. As a new contractor, please read the validator's edge-case notes before making changes, since several behaviors are intentional even though they look like bugs. The background, test fixtures, and acceptance criteria are gathered on this internal page:

operations page: https://confluence.qorvellabs.internal/projects/projects/projects/pages/a358

Subject: Quickstore 4.2 — bloom filter now fronts the KV layer

Plugin authors: starting with this release, Quickstore places a bloom filter ahead of the key-value store. Negative lookups return faster; false positives fall through safely. No API changes are required on your side. Verify your plugin against the staging build referenced below.

session token of fahif-tadup = htk3_9c7

## Changelog — Tidemark Widget 3.2

Defaults changed. Read before touching anything.

- Refresh interval now hourly, not every 15 min. Harbor feeds from the Pellisport aggregator throttle aggressive polling.
- Lunar-offset correction is on by default. Disable only for legacy Kestrel Bay deployments.
- Chart units default to metric. The imperial fallback flag is deprecated and will be removed in 3.4.
- Cache eviction is now time-based, not size-based.

New installs should start from the default configuration values listed below.

config for kahap-taweg:
oliox:
  pin: 8609
  tenant: casath
  seal: seal_632a4a6f
  metrics_host: metrics.oliox.nelvrogrid.example
  standby_team: keleth
  escalation: briiel-oliwyn
  nonce: e2397c

Ticket: Vault locked — TZ fix for report exports stuck

The Quillbox signing vault locked mid-release, blocking the patch that normalizes export timestamps to UTC before applying the tenant's display offset. Review the diff in the meantime; the DST edge cases are in the second commit. To unlock the vault and resume the release pipeline, enter the recovery passphrase below.

unlock words, tawif-tahop: oliys-ulawyn-tamdor-lamys-casox-jormir-fraius-kasath-ulador-ulamir-holir-sorys-holeth